DEPARTMENT OF AGRICULTURE
Rural Utilities Service
7 CFR Part 1780
Procurement Methods; Correction
AGENCY: Rural Utilities Service, Agriculture.
ACTION: Correcting amendment.
-----------------------------------------------------------------------
SUMMARY: The Rural Utilities Service (RUS), an agency of the United
States Department of Agriculture (USDA), is correcting its portion of
USDA's uniform federal assistance final rule, that was published in the
Federal Register on February 16, 2016 (81 FR 7695) by revising the
procurement methods section.

S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ION: On December 26, 2013, OMB published Uniform
Administrative Requirements, Cost Principles, and Audit Requirements
for Federal Awards final guidance (78 FR 78589) giving all federal
award making agencies one year to implement conforming changes to all
regulations as needed to address changes in requirements associated
with this new Uniform Guidance. On December 19, 2014, OMB published a
joint interim final rule and conforming changes in the Federal Register
(79 FR 75871), making the conforming changes for award making agencies
across the Federal government. Included in this joint interim final
rule were conforming changes to regulations regarding procurement
methods under Federal awards for the Rural Utilities Service Water and
Waste Disposal program to ensure consistency with the Uniform Guidance.
Need for Correction
The United States Department of Agriculture finalized its portion
of the conforming changes in the Federal Register on Tuesday, February
16, 2016 (81 FR 7695), that inadvertently stated instructions in Sec.
1780.72, as published, which contains errors that may prove to be
misleading and need to be clarified.

2. Revise Sec. 1780.72 to read as follows:
Sec. 1780.72 Procurement methods.
Procurement shall be made by one of the following methods and in
accordance with requirements of 2 CFR 200.320: Micro-purchases,
procurement by small purchase procedures, procurement by sealed bids
(formal advertising), procurement by competitive proposals, or
procurement by noncompetitive proposals. The sealed bid method is the
preferred method for procuring construction.
